Title says it all. By “intense” I mean hard-living conditions which despise lives. BTW sorry if there are any threads talking about the same subject, I cannot read ALL the threads
Alright, time to share my story with you. I also prepared screenshots for you but I’ll show them next post because I’m writing this post on my phone.
So I decided to create a “4th attempt” HC world. Little did I know where it was gonna spawn me: a Mushroom Island! (that world didn’t last long though)
Fun fact: I technically spawned in an ocean biome, because near my spawn point was a patch of grass. Pressing F3 labels this grass as minecraft:ocean while it labels the mycelium as minecraft:mushroom_fields_shore.
And the worst part? The mushroom island was entirely surrounded by ocean, no mainland nearby...Which meant I’d have to swim out to sea to gather my necessary resources. And just my luck, I found a shipwreck! Primary reason was not the loot, but the masts which I used as wood supplies. I managed to get 4 pieces of oak logs and suddenly drowned, which knocked me down to 2 hearts... I went back to the mushroom island and crafted all these logs into planks, then made a crafting table and a pickaxe. I mined some stone and coal as well. Then I killed some Mooshrooms for food and only 2 pieces of steak managed to fully restore my health back
I went back to the shipwreck and managed to chop down the rest of the logs faster with my stone axe, constantly backing up to regenerate my oxygen bar. I also managed to get some loot from the shipwreck, one of which being a buried treasure map, however I didn’t follow the X right now. I decided to craft a boat and venture down the seas in the hopes of finding the mainland, but I’d return back to the mushroom island to build my house there (I like the “no hostile mobs spawning” aspect :P)
I found a desert biome (luckily I found a tree) and another shipwreck as well. I ran into the desert and found a savanna not too long after. I found some sheep to make a bed but only 2 of them ....
Well here ends my story. Share yours down below!
